About the RoleAs the new Senior Partnerships Manager at EdgeTier, it will be your responsibility to build EdgeTier's partnership programme from scratch. No two days within this role are likely to be the same as you lead initiatives to identify, recruit, and enable high-performing channel partners.While you will be the sole individual responsible for driving sales through partnerships, you will work closely with cross-functional teams. This role is pivotal in scaling EdgeTier's distribution channels and enhancing market presence with a focus on long-term and sustainable growth. If you're ready for a chance to roll your sleeves up, get stuck in, and build something that you can be both excited by and proud of - this is the role for you!What You'll DoDesign and execute channel sales strategies to achieve company revenue targets. Build and maintain relationships with sales channel partners. Develop partner resources, collateral, and enablement tools to optimise performance. Collaborate with sales, marketing, tech, and product teams to align strategies and messaging. Monitor partner performance and provide actionable insights to improve outcomes. Ensure compliance in partner agreements and maintain accurate reporting. How Your Time Will Be Spent:Partner recruitment, onboarding, and enablement with quick win partners in current network: 40%Sales driven program material development: 30%Collaboration with internal teams to align and execute initiatives: 20%Reporting and administrative tasks: 10%Who You AreYou're a Senior Partnership Manager with previous success delivering sales results through a partner program.
